Laminate Flooring

Laminate flooring uses a click-lock system and requires proper underlay, expansion gaps, and subfloor preparation. Our guidance helps distributors and contractors reduce issues such as edge lifting, gaps, and noise complaints after installation.

Rigid Core Flooring

Rigid core flooring, including SPC and WPC, requires a clean, dry, and flat subfloor to ensure stable locking performance. We provide guidance for floating installation, underlay selection, and common site-condition risks in residential and commercial projects.

LVT/LVP Flooring

LVT/LVP flooring may use glue-down or click installation depending on the product structure. Our support helps buyers confirm adhesive compatibility, subfloor smoothness, and installation methods before project delivery.

Underlay

Underlay affects sound insulation, walking comfort, moisture protection, and long-term floor stability. We help buyers select suitable underlay for laminate, SPC, WPC, and project-specific installation requirements.

Installation Methods for Different Patterns

Different flooring patterns require different installation precision and techniques. Below are key considerations for common layouts used in residential and commercial projects.

herringbone install
chevron install
parquet flooring install
diagonal flooring install

Herringbone Pattern

Herringbone installation requires high precision and experienced installers. Each plank must be aligned accurately, and cutting errors can affect the entire layout.

This pattern is commonly used in high-end residential and commercial projects.

Chevron Pattern

Chevron patterns require pre-cut planks at fixed angles, making installation more demanding than standard layouts. Any deviation in angle or alignment will be visually noticeable.

This method is suitable for projects with skilled installers and controlled site conditions.

Square Tile Layout

Square tile patterns are easier to install compared to herringbone or chevron, but still require consistent alignment and spacing control.

They are often used in commercial areas where visual structure and installation efficiency need to be balanced.

Straight Lay Install

Straight lay is the most common and efficient installation method. It allows faster installation and lower labor cost, making it suitable for large-scale projects.

This layout is widely used in distribution and wholesale markets where consistency and efficiency are priorities.

Installation Risk Control

From real export experience, most flooring complaints are caused by installation issues rather than product defects.

Common Risks We Help Prevent:
- Uneven subfloor
- Incorrect expansion gaps
- Improper locking installation
- Wrong underlay or accessory selection

Early-stage guidance significantly reduces after-sales issues, project delays, and unnecessary costs.
